    @VTi EG6 - I would have your local dealer pricematch Toyota of Cool Springs or Olathe whichever is currently cheaper. It'll save you shipping cost and then you deal locally. Lead time is typically only a day or two and then if there is any damage, you get immediate gratification and don't have to deal with shipping back. Email the parts manager a screenshot of their cart/checkout page from one of the other dealers. I saved close to $150+ that way. Mine were $692 + tax with a price match to Toyota of Cool Springs, didn't have to pay shipping or any kind. Dealer list price was $860 + tax without price match.
